It was one of the final FIFA titles to rely heavily on physical media (CD-ROM) for the PC platform before the industry shifted toward DVD and digital downloads. 3. Technical Mechanism of the CD Key
The CD key served as a "proof of purchase" during the installation process. Unlike modern games that require constant internet connectivity, FIFA 2005 keys were typically validated offline via an algorithm stored on the disc. Usually formatted as XXXX-XXXX-XXXX-XXXX-XXXX
The key was often printed on the back of the instruction manual or a sticker inside the jewel case. Authentication:
Once entered, the key was written to the Windows Registry, allowing the game executable to launch. 4. Legacy and the Shift to Digital

is a legacy title, and finding a CD key today depends on whether you own the original physical copy or are trying to run it on modern hardware. 💿 Where to Find Your Original Key
If you own the physical retail box, the 20-digit alphanumeric code is typically located in one of these spots: Inside the Case: On a white sticker behind the disc tray. Manual Back Cover:
Printed on the bottom of the last page of the instruction booklet. Manual Front Cover: Sometimes printed on the bottom of the first page. Paper Insert:
On a separate "Quick Start" or registration card inside the box. ⚠️ Important Compatibility Notes Since FIFA 2005 was released in
